The university wordmark is a graphic that has been precisely designed with specific measurements and placement of visual elements. To alter any of these relationships will undermine the purposes of having a consistent and recognizable institutional identity.
The official wordmark (see below) must appear on the front cover of every publication and prominently in any advertisement or display.

The wordmark must not be changed or embellished in any way other than proportional sizing. The wordmark may be reversed out of a solid background color but must be treated as a solid image when overprinting a patterned background. No type or graphics should overprint the wordmark. One-color reproduction of the wordmark may be printed in the color of the publication. In a two-color publication the wordmark may appear in either of the two colors providing there is adequate contrast, or it may be reversed out. Note that no version of the wordmark uses the abbreviated form "UW-Eau Claire."

If you would like to incorporate your department/office name with the wordmark, the department/office name must appear in the typeface Giovanni. If you choose to use a different font to represent your department/office, there must be sufficient visual separation from the wordmark. Other program marks (symbols, lettermarks and logos) that UW-Eau Claire colleges, schools, departments, units, programs and offices use to identify themselves may be included in university publications. However, the university wordmark must be prominent and there must be sufficient separation between the program mark and the wordmark. There must also be sufficient separation between the program mark and the university seal/medallion. See the following examples of the correct use of program marks in university publications:
